I don't have a cross slide vice for my drill press, I haven't bought one yet because the cheap ones are just way too loose to be any good and a good tight one is expensive. Besides, if I had a good one I'd have to either buy a better drill press or mod mine to take the slop out of the arbor/chuck. But I have done a little crud milling by rigging a straight edge fixed to the table to the correct setting then sliding/feeding the piece by hand. Doesn't make pretty cuts, has to be soft metal and the cuts have to be lite but it has got me where I needed to go in the past so I'll try to take a little off the inside, I'll only need to mill about half the depth which will make it easier. I bought three of them along with spare battery packs back when they had that big sale, I use them more then those that I built simply because it's easy to swap out the battery when I need to. I use one for a charger and the other two for daily vaping the two flavors I use. They are bigger and heavier then I wanted but they just work and it's a two second battery swap.

For giggles I put a 75 in one and made a battery pack with three 900mah cells in parallel, worked fine but I didn't gain any extended battery life over the stock dx and I had to wait for it to charge so I put it back to a stock dx. But now that I have some 21700 cells I'm thinking of how to use them with a 75 or 60 board and which mod that I already have that I can do that with. Could build another mod using a hammond box, I have a couple extra but I don't feel like investing that much work right now. I'll probably mod the hanna clone box so the 21700 will fit, it already has the 75 in it.
